High-Quality Brakes

Electric scooters require a braking system that is responsive. It is important to maintain your brakes in good shape, whether they are disc, electronic regenerative or drum brakes. This will ensure that you are safe and in control.

Disc brakes are the most popular choice for electric scooters, offering superior stopping power and control. They also charge the battery when they brake. The levers can be operated with a hand, but the majority of people prefer the levers mounted on the handlebar are more comfortable and safe to use.

The drum brakes on an e-scooter are very similar to those on bicycles, putting friction to the wheel by mechanically shortening the cable that connects to a caliper, which then pinches the wheel's rotor. They are incredibly basic and affordable, however their braking power isn't as powerful as disc brakes.

The motors come with electronic and regenerative brakes built-in, making them more difficult to use. They are also less susceptible to overheating. However, they typically have less stopping power than disc brakes. If you decide to buy an electric scooter that comes with brakes that are this type, be sure to follow the correct technique for riding and not push the brakes to the limit. Regular bleeding of the brakes can help to remove air bubbles from the system and ensure it working properly.
